Code: *************************************** Thanks DESCRIPTION Because of their complexity and scale, metro structures capture all the essential aspects of a cut-and-cover structure, and so are given primary focus in this book. The design of a metro construction is outlined coherently and in detail; and the reader is shown how to apply this design process equally well to other, relatively simple, cut-and-cover structures. Geotechnical and structural engineering principles are combined with both design and construction practice to make this book a unique guide for engineers. CONTENT 1 Introduction 2 General Planning 3 Structural Form 4 Construction Overview 5 Ground and Wall Support 6 Groundwater Control 7 Interaction – I 8 Interaction – II 9 Interaction – III 10 Conceptual Design 11 Engineering Properties of Soils 12 Identification of Loads 13 Assessment of Earth Pressures 14 Assessment of Surcharge Loads 15 Assessment of Seismic Loads 16 Slurry Trench Stability – I 17 Slurry Trench Stability – II 18 Groundwater Flow 19 Phenomenon of Heave 20 Prediction of Heave 21 Containment of Heave 22 Flotation 23 Design Parameters 24 Load Factors & Combinations 25 Modelling & Boundary Conditions 26 Structural Analysis – I 27 Structural Analysis – II Appendices A:Typical Loadings & Parameters B: Design of Derailment Barrier C: Identification of Soil Types D: Stability of Simple Slopes E: Diffusion of Stress Relief |
